Are you familiar with the hdparm command? For giggles you might do some performance testing. Running sudo hdparm -t /dev/<whatever> will run for a few seconds and give you an indication of what speed you can read from the device at. For example, on my laptop I do sudo hdparm -t /dev/nvme0n1 and it responds with /dev/nvme0n1: Timing buffered disk reads: 6330 MB in 3.00 seconds = 2109.97 MB/sec
The original disk in my wife's venerable 2009 laptop had this results sudo hdparm -t /dev/sda /dev/sda: Timing buffered disk reads: 234 MB in 3.00 seconds = 77.96 MB/sec with its original disk, and after replacing with an SSD at some point, it went to /dev/sda: Timing buffered disk reads: 818 MB in 3.01 seconds = 272.01 MB/sec
The SATA bus in that computer maxed out at 280 MB/sec (or something around there) and so we didn't get the full benefit of the SSD's speed, but it gave the laptop a new lease on life. The increase in speed of the laptop was very dramatic.

My experience with my Ecoflow (Delta 2 model + extra battery) is that it will give you something like 80% of the rated power. So I have (nominally) 2 kWh, which should run one 250-watt device for 8 hours. But I suspect I probably end up with about 6.5 hours (or so) of power. YMMV.
